Abstract

The utility model discloses a cow delivery room relates to cow delivery technical field. A cow delivery room comprises a delivery room body, a base plate and a top cover, wherein the delivery room body is in a frame structure formed by four plates in a surrounding mode, the base plate is arranged at the bottom of the delivery room body, the top cover is arranged at the top of the delivery room body, a temperature sensor is arranged on the side wall of the delivery room body, and a heating device is arranged on the top cover; one end of the heating device is connected with the power supply, and the other end of the heating device is connected with the main control device; the temperature sensor transmits the detected information to the main control device, and the main control device transmits the detected temperature information to the liquid crystal display for display, judgment and processing are carried out, and the heating device is controlled to work. This design provides a cow delivery room, can build the warm environment in the delivery room, has reduced because environmental factor leads to cow and the probability that the calf just born is sick to influence calf survival rate and cow milk yield, improved economic benefits.

Background
Cow parturition management is the core work of cow farms, and feeding management before and after parturition plays a particularly important role in ensuring the health and the service life of cows and improving the milk production capacity and the fertility. The delivery room is the place where the cows are delivered, and the cows should be sent into the delivery room within 1-2 weeks before the cows are delivered, so that the calves are guaranteed to be smoothly born and the calves which are just born are prevented from being trampled by other cows to be delivered; after the cow produces the calf, the calf and the cow are separated within 30 minutes, the trunk of the calf is wiped clean by hay or dry cloth, the establishment of the relationship between the calf and the cow is prevented, the milking difficulty is increased, the cow which is just delivered is in a weak period, the immune system of the calf which is just born is not completely developed, and a warm and dry environment needs to be provided for the calf and the cow; cow delivery room among the prior art only uses simple and easy fence or has ventilation effect's airtight space as the delivery room, and the two can't guarantee the temperature in the delivery room under cold condition, easily makes the calf and the cow that has just parturied ill to influence the output of milk and the survival rate of calf, cause economic loss. Therefore, a delivery room capable of providing a warm and comfortable environment is necessary for cow breeding.

As shown in fig. 1-3, a cow delivery room comprises a delivery room body 1, a base plate 2, a top cover 3, a main control device 7 and a liquid crystal display 9, wherein the delivery room body 1 is formed by four plates in a frame-shaped structure, the base plate 2 is arranged at the bottom of the delivery room body 1, the top cover 3 is arranged at the top of the delivery room body 1, a temperature sensor 6 is arranged on the side wall of the delivery room body 1, and a heating device 8 is arranged on the top cover 3; the switch of the heating device 8 is connected with the main control device 7, and the main control device 7 is connected with the liquid crystal display 9; the temperature sensor 6 transmits the detected information to the main control device 7, and the main control device 7 transmits the detected temperature information to the liquid crystal display 9 for display, judgment and processing, and controls the heating device 8 to work.
After temperature sensor 6 in the room of childbirth switched on, temperature sensor 6 began constantly to detect the indoor temperature of childbirth room to transmit to master control unit 7, master control unit 7 carries out liquid crystal display with the data that temperature sensor 6 detected, and master control unit 7 judges the processing to the temperature information that detects simultaneously, and when being less than preset temperature value, master control unit 7 gives trigger signal, and control heating device 8 carries out work.
The temperature sensor 6 detects the temperature in the delivery room, transmits the temperature to the main control device 7, performs liquid crystal display, and controls the heating device 8 to work, thereby providing a warm environment for the cows in the delivery room and the calves which are born.
The heating device 8 is a lamp heater. The lamp warms up fast, power is little, power consumptive fewly, and its infrared ray that gives off still has the effect that promotes blood circulation moreover, through the warm setting of 8 lamps of heating device, when practicing thrift economic cost, more do benefit to the growth of cow and calf.
As shown in fig. 3, the delivery room body 1 is provided with a slide rail 4 on the top plate, and the top cover 3 can move horizontally relative to the delivery room body 1. Through the design of the top cover 3 that can give birth to room body 1 horizontal migration relatively for in sunny weather, can let the cow shower to sunshine, improve the milk yield of cow, increase economic benefits.
As shown in fig. 2, the side plate of the delivery room body 1 is provided with a vent hole 5. A dry and ventilated environment can be maintained in the delivery room through the ventilation holes 5 designed on the side plates of the delivery room body 1.
